| | |
| | | @PostMapping("/bus/save") |
| | | public R save(@RequestBody BusCreateParam param) { |
| | | OpenBusSubmitParam submitParam = new OpenBusSubmitParam(); |
| | | submitParam.setBatch(param.getBatch()); |
| | | submitParam.setBatch(param.getBusNo()); |
| | | for (TaskIdByLongDto dto : param.getTaskList()) { |
| | | TaskDto taskDto = new TaskDto(); |
| | | taskDto.setSeqNum(dto.getSeqNum()); |
| | |
| | | taskDto.setOriSta(staService.getById(dto.getOriSta()).getStaNo()); |
| | | } |
| | | if (!Cools.isEmpty(dto.getOriLoc())) { |
| | | taskDto.setOriSta(locService.getById(dto.getOriLoc()).getLocNo()); |
| | | taskDto.setOriLoc(locService.getById(dto.getOriLoc()).getLocNo()); |
| | | } |
| | | if (!Cools.isEmpty(dto.getDestSta())) { |
| | | taskDto.setOriSta(staService.getById(dto.getDestSta()).getStaNo()); |
| | | taskDto.setDestSta(staService.getById(dto.getDestSta()).getStaNo()); |
| | | } |
| | | if (!Cools.isEmpty(dto.getDestLoc())) { |
| | | taskDto.setOriSta(locService.getById(dto.getDestLoc()).getLocNo()); |
| | | taskDto.setDestLoc(locService.getById(dto.getDestLoc()).getLocNo()); |
| | | } |
| | | submitParam.getTaskList().add(taskDto); |
| | | } |